To treat the aches,... WebMay 1, 2013 · There are also many simple measures that can help relieve arthritis pain and stiffness: Heat and cold. Take a warm bath, apply cold compresses, or wrap some frozen vegetables in a towel and hold them to your painful joints. Heat, cold, or alternating the two can be very effective at relieving pain. WebBut they have some tips that might reduce the severity of your symptoms and possibly stop the arthritis from getting worse, including: Maintain a healthy weight. Exercise using low-impact activities (swimming, cycling) instead of high-impact activities (jogging, tennis). Aim for about 150 minutes of exercise per week. Smoking boosts inflammation, and RA involves inflammation that’s out of control because your immune system attacks your own healthy tissues by mistake ... high delta vs low delta optionsWebThe amount of cartilage loss varies from person to person and so do symptoms of shoulder arthritis: Pain in the shoulder joint is the major sign of arthritis. It can be present in the front, side or back of the shoulder. Some people have pain even when they are not using the arm, and some have pain only when using it.
